Jimmy G isn't a top 10 QB. The guy is just super limited in what he can do.

He's not good at throwing down the field or outside the numbers. He's not mobile (he's a statue compared to most modern QBs) and doesn't handle pressure well. He's actually pretty turnover prone. He's not comfortable in the drop back passing game, almost all of his production comes off of playaction to easy reads over the middle of the field. The guy is also 28 and has played his entire 7 year career under excellent coaching staffs, there's not much reason to think he's going to dramatically change as a player.
